Volatus Aerospace (TSX: FLT) reported a mixed second-quarter performance for fiscal 2026, with earnings per share meeting expectations while revenue significantly underperformed against analyst forecasts. The aerospace company logged quarterly losses of $(0.01) per share, aligning precisely with the consensus estimate and remaining flat compared to the same period last year.

Despite the inline bottom line, the top-line figures revealed substantial pressure. Quarterly sales came in at $8.419 million, missing the analyst consensus estimate of $11.334 million by a wide margin of 25.72 percent. This shortfall underscores a broader contraction in business activity, as sales decreased by 20.48 percent year-over-year from $10.587 million in the corresponding quarter of the previous fiscal year. However, on a sequential basis, revenue increased 49.5% quarter-over-quarter, with equipment delivery rising 38% and services growing 59% compared to Q1 2026.

Financial Performance Overview

The divergence between the stable per-share loss and the sharp revenue decline highlights the operational challenges faced during the quarter. While the company managed to keep its per-share loss within expected bounds, the significant miss on revenue suggests potential issues in order conversion or project delivery timelines that did not impact the immediate earnings per share calculation but signal underlying demand or execution headwinds. Management attributed the year-over-year revenue decline primarily to a single defence contract representing approximately $2.6 million, for which delivery was not completed within the quarter due to continued supply chain disruption. Excluding this impact, revenue from the balance of the business grew modestly year over year.

The gross margin for the quarter stood at 29.3%, down from 31.9% in Q2 2025, reflecting a higher proportion of defence programs in the mix. Adjusted EBITDA widened to a loss of $(4.35) million, attributable to an increase in operating expenses and lower gross profit contribution due to the change in product mix. Operating expenses rose significantly, driven by growth-stage investments in the defence vertical, the establishment of the Mirabel manufacturing base, and technology platform development.

Balance Sheet and Operational Milestones

A key positive development was the company’s strengthened liquidity position. Volatus exited the quarter with cash of $59.2 million and working capital of $63.8 million, described as the strongest liquidity position in its history. This improvement followed a $34.5 million bought deal public offering closed in June 2026. Total assets increased 28% to $118.8 million from year-end 2025, while interest-bearing borrowings decreased to $9.7 million from $11.7 million.

Operationally, the company marked a decisive step in its transition into a sovereign aerospace and defence platform. In June 2026, Volatus opened its 53,000-square-foot manufacturing and systems integration facility at Montreal-Mirabel International Airport. This infrastructure supports the scaling of domestic production and the advancement of proprietary technologies, including the V-Cortexâ„¢ AI flight controller introduced at CANSEC 2026.

What the Numbers Show

The most striking feature of this quarter is the disconnect between the earnings per share result and the revenue reality. While the EPS met expectations, the revenue miss of nearly 26 percent against consensus indicates that analysts had overly optimistic views on sales volume or pricing. The fact that the EPS remained unchanged year-over-year despite a 20 percent drop in revenue suggests that cost structures may have adjusted downward in tandem with sales, or that fixed costs absorbed the variance without impacting the per-share loss magnitude.

Furthermore, the widening Adjusted EBITDA loss to $(4.35) million, compared to $(0.29) million in the prior year period, highlights the aggressive investment phase the company is undergoing. Operating expenses surged, particularly in personnel and advertising/marketing, as Volatus builds out its Mirabel facility and defence capabilities. The record cash position provides a buffer for these investments, allowing the company to pursue larger government and commercial programs without relying on near-term operating cash flow.

Strategic Outlook

Volatus continues to deepen its presence across established commercial verticals, including energy, utilities, and infrastructure inspection, while expanding into government, public safety, and allied defence markets. The company is advancing the commercialization of its proprietary technology portfolio, including the SKYDRAâ„¢ C-UAS SaaS platform, aiming for higher-value, recurring software revenue. Recent strategic partnerships, including collaborations with Kraus Hamdani Aerospace and Singular Aircraft, underscore its focus on sovereign Canadian persistent intelligence capability and autonomous aircraft solutions.

Concordia University, through its Volt-Age research program, and Volatus Aerospace have signed a memorandum of understanding (MOU) to establish a strategic framework for collaboration on energy technologies for uncrewed aircraft systems (UAS). The agreement, announced on July 21, 2026, aims to combine academic research, operational testing, and industry expertise to accelerate the development, validation, and commercialization of Canadian technologies for civil, commercial, and strategic drone platforms. The partners will explore opportunities for applied research, technology demonstration, talent development, and jointly funded strategic initiatives.

The collaboration seeks to strengthen Canada's technological sovereignty in the UAS sector, which is increasingly vital for critical infrastructure, public safety, environmental monitoring, Arctic operations, and dual-use applications. By supporting the development of a more resilient Canadian supply chain for strategic drone components, the partners aim to advance domestic innovation while reducing reliance on foreign entities of concern. The MOU establishes a framework for identifying and pursuing collaborative research, validation, and technology demonstration projects involving researchers, students, industry partners, and public-sector organizations.

Glen Lynch, Chief Executive Officer of Volatus Aerospace, emphasized the significance of connecting Volt-Age’s research capabilities with Volatus’ operational, testing, and manufacturing infrastructure. He stated that this collaboration will help move promising energy technologies from the laboratory into real-world aircraft and operational environments, supporting the broader objective of building sovereign, Canadian-developed capabilities for commercial, public safety, and strategic applications.

Dr. Tim Evans, Vice-President, Research and Innovation at Concordia University, highlighted that Volt-Age was created to accelerate the development of technologies powering Canada's energy transition. He noted that the collaboration with Volatus reflects the approach of bringing together researchers, industry, and institutional partners to transform scientific excellence into innovations addressing Canada's strategic needs. The goal is to create an environment where next-generation energy technologies for unmanned aircraft systems can be developed, tested, and commercialized.

Specific projects and implementation activities under the MOU will be governed by separate agreements as opportunities arise. The partnership underscores a shared commitment to advancing the UAS sector through integrated efforts in research, development, and commercialization.
